The cost to replace a septic tank can vary depending on factors such as size, location, and any additional repairs needed. On average, the cost can range from 3,000 to 7,000. It is recommended to get quotes from multiple contractors to get an accurate estimate for your specific situation.

How much would it cost to get septic tank pumping?

You cannot say for sure, it all depends on where you live, but generally, the cost to have your septic tank pumped is around $70 to $200 dollars to have your septic tank pumped by professionals.


How much does it cost to fix a cracked septic tank?

The cost to fix a cracked septic tank can vary depending on the extent of the damage and the specific repair needed. On average, repairing a cracked septic tank can cost anywhere from 500 to 2,000 or more. It is recommended to contact a professional septic tank repair service for an accurate estimate.
